### Partner SFTP Drop — Graintrail

Overnight, Graintrail uploads settlement files to our partner SFTP drop, which the Ferryline ingest service polls every 15 minutes. If files stall, check the ingest logs in Pulseview before paging the partner liaison. The ingest service authenticates to the internal validation API before moving files downstream. When re-running ingestion manually, you'll need the service key, which is provided below.

API key for yahig-tadup: kto7_ubizbYm

The Gridforge API generates crossword puzzles from a supplied word list via `POST /v2/puzzles`. Request bodies must specify grid dimensions (max 21x21), a symmetry mode, and an optional theme slug; the service returns a puzzle ID you can poll for completion. Rate limits are 60 requests per minute per key, and contractors receive sandbox quotas only. Every request must carry an Authorization header; for sandbox work, use the bearer token below.

session JWT of yahif-bawig = eyJhbGciOiJIUzI1NiIsInR5cCI6IkpXVCJ9.eyJzdWIiOiIaWAxmMIn0.GYffpIaj

Release checklist — RestockPilot v2.4: confirm the vending-machine restock planner correctly deprioritizes machines flagged offline by the Kellhaven depot feed. Verify route exports open in PlannerView without the truncation seen last sprint. Smoke-test the low-stock alert threshold at 15% across all three test fleets. Once QA signs off, tag the candidate build and note the identifier below.

build token for kagaf-hahof: htk14_9d3d4d26d7d8de

Runbook: account recovery for the Parityline test harness. When reviewing parity changes between the Kestrelkit iOS and Android SDKs, you may find the shared test account locked after repeated automated logins. Unlock it via the Parityline admin panel rather than creating a new account, since fixtures depend on its ID. The panel will prompt for the recovery passphrase, which follows below.

vault phrase of bahap-hahop = novath-fenir-tamion-kelath-ruswyn